AppleTV+ Is Now Available to Android Users

AppleTV+ Is Now Available to Android Users

AppleTV+ is now available for Android users to download. It’s a rare step by Apple to make its own apps available to non-iOS systems. Apple has been pushing to increase recurring revenue at its services businesses, including AppleTV+. Apple’s streaming platform is officially available on Android devices. Why the S&P 500 Is Due for 5 Years of Dismal Returns Ahead

Why the S&P 500 Is Due for 5 Years of Dismal Returns Ahead

The Magnificent Seven stocks’ dominance may soon fade, warns Glenmede Investment Management. Current market concentration levels mirror those of 1929 and 1999, signaling potential risks.
